Added support for annotation session-cookie-change-on-failure
1. Session cookie is updated on previous attempt failure when `session-cookie-change-on-failure = true` (default value is `false`). 2. Added tests to check both cases. 3. Updated docs. Co-Authored-By: Vladimir Grishin <yadolov@users.noreply.github.com>
